WebSelect the Start button, then type settings. Select Settings > Network & internet > VPN > Add VPN. In Add a VPN connection, do the following: For VPN provider, choose Windows (built-in). In the Connection name box, enter a name you'll recognize (for example, My Personal VPN). This is the VPN connection name you'll look for when connecting.
